you can also get the 'blue' in little 'dry' tea bags ,which are fine and take up less room in the van

If its just the weekend then I don't bother with any , might stink in the warmer months a bit but I've handled and smelt worse :shock:
if your on 'site' then empty it in the morning .. rinse and ready to go again , saves money and I'm not a fan of chemicals
you can also get 'green' chemicals ,ecco friendly but folk have reported them to be not so good
